Charles S. Goldman

cgoldman@bowlesverna.com

Charles S. Goldman is the senior attorney devoted exclusively to corporate and business transactional law and estate planning at Bowles & Verna LLP. Mr. Goldman has considerable experience in an extensive range of transactional matters. He provides legal representation to retail, technology, real property and other commercial businesses in start-ups, financing, acquisitions and sales, combinations (mergers, partnerships, joint ventures and limited liability companies), and management and operation of businesses. He also counsels clients in asset preservation strategies, including family partnerships and estate plans.

Mr. Goldman is a 1980 graduate of the UCLA School of Law, where he was a member of the UCLA Law Review. He earned his undergraduate degree in Journalism, with Distinction, from the University of California at Berkeley. He is a member of the State Bar of California, the Contra Costa County Bar Association and the American Bar Association.

Mr. Goldman’s areas of practice include the following:

Corporate and Business Law

Acquisitions and sales: Negotiation and documentation of transactions involving privately held companies in a variety of businesses, including asset and stock purchases and sales, mergers and spin-offs. Extensive experience in managing transactions from preliminary negotiations to closing, including preparation of letters of intent, definitive agreements, due diligence (including environmental matters, title and third party claims), legal opinions, and organizing and managing closings. Bulk sale transactions; stock redemption agreements; loan purchase agreements.

Combination strategies: Negotiation and documentation of limited and general partnership agreements, limited liability companies and joint ventures for business operations (retail, technology and others) and investments (including real property acquisitions).

Business counseling: Advice on choice of entity (“C” and “S” corporations, general and limited partnerships, limited liability companies). Long range structural planning; employment and personnel policies. Negotiation and documentation of employment and consultant agreements, shareholder agreements (management and control, buy-sell, life insurance), service contracts, computer and other equipment leases and purchases.

Intellectual property: Technology licensing and acquisition; evaluation and prosecution of federal and state trademark and service marks; trade secrets protection (confidentiality agreements, risk management).

Real Property Law

Purchase and sale transactions: Negotiation and documentation of transactions in commercial, industrial, retail and residential developments and multi-residential projects. Extensive experience in managing transactions from preliminary negotiations to closing, including preparation of letters of intent, purchase and sale documentation, due diligence (environmental matters, title, tenancies, development rights, governmental restrictions), legal opinions, and organizing and managing closings.

Leasing: Office buildings, retail properties (regional, community and local shopping centers, mini-malls and single-user assets), industrial and warehouse properties, ground leases and multi-residential buildings. Lease assignments and subleases. Representation of both landlords and tenants in all types of properties.

Ownership and development: Co-tenancies, partnerships and limited liability companies; covenants, conditions and restrictions; easements. Construction, architectural, engineering and development management agreements.

Finance: Negotiation and documentation of purchase and construction financing, refinance, workouts.

Estate Planning

Planning and implementation of business succession plans, including family partnerships and limited liability companies with gifting programs, living trusts and related vehicles. Mr. Goldman also works with estate planning specialists in setting up gift trusts, charitable trusts and life insurance trusts.

Personal Information

Mr. Goldman has lived in California since migrating from Cleveland in 1962. He was a founding actor, graphic designer and first business manager of San Francisco’s famed drama company, the Magic Theatre. He retains an active interest in graphic arts. He serves on the advisory board of the Vajrayana Foundation Tibetan Arts Institute, which is dedicated to preserving and teaching the sacred arts of the Tibetan tradition.
